Registry tweaks on GitHub are a popular way for power users to optimize Windows 10 for performance, privacy, and aesthetic customization. These tweaks are typically shared as .reg files or PowerShell/Batch scripts that automate the modification of specific "keys" in the Windows Registry—the system's central database for settings.

Avoid scripts that remove Windows Defender or User Account Control (UAC) completely via the registry unless you are deploying a highly specialized, completely air-gapped machine.

Completely breaking Windows Update leaves your machine highly vulnerable to security exploits. Instead, look for tweaks that merely pause updates or disable forced automatic reboots.
